Enhancement of Mechanoluminescent Intensity of ZnS:Mn by Addition of Ga.

Abstract
In order to develop new bright phosphors with long-lasting mechanoluminescence(ML), we prepared ZnS:Mn containing a small amount of Ga and investigated the effect of Ga ion doping on the mechanoluminescent properties. The ML intensity becomes two times lager by adding 0.1mol% Ga ion to ZnS:Mn phosphor, and the intensity decreases with increasing the concentration of Ga ion. In ML spectra of Ga-doped ZnS:Mn, the peak shifts are small and the peak widths are narrower in comparison with those in the photoluminescence spectra.
